Welcome to Coach Trav’s Mental Health Playbook: The Athlete’s Journey to Self-Discovery, a podcast dedicated to empowering athletes to embrace their identity beyond the game. This show is a safe space where professional, collegiate, and high school athletes are encouraged to explore their purpose, share their stories, and take pride in who they are as individuals. Athletes are more than the “”machines”” they’re often portrayed as—they are people with unique gifts, passions, and aspirations beyond their sport.
In this week’s episode of The Mental Health Playbook, we’re tackling a topic that often goes unspoken in the sports world: the mental battles athletes face behind the scenes. Social media shows us highlight reels—game-winning plays, championship celebrations, and personal bests—but rarely do we see the private moments when athletes are struggling with self-doubt, negativity, or mental darkness. Lou Adams, former NFL player and current General Manager of the LEAD Prep Academy in Brighton, MI, joins us to share his experiences.
